What they do

A Data Entry Clerk types or scans information into a computer to create databases, programs or summary data reports. Transcribes handwritten information from order forms, receipts or other documents to type into a computerized record, or enters data for medical records, or enters data in code to update company websites.

Data Entry Specialist National Time & Signal - 3.2 Wixom, MI Job Details Full-time From $20 an hour 1 day ago Benefits Health savings account Health insurance Dental insurance 401(k) Tuition reimbursement Paid time off 401(k) matching Life insurance Qualifications Accounting systems Microsoft Excel Customer service Spreadsheets Accounting software Financial report writing Payroll Full Job Description We are looking for someone to add to our office team that has excellent telephone skills and the understanding of general office processes & procedures. The position includes the daily front office tasks and responsibilities such as order contract management, lead generation, accounting, answering phones, filing, order entry, processing payments, and other office tasks. The ideal candidate will have experience in a fast-paced and multi-focused office setting, have good problem-solving skills, pays close attention to details, and has above average computer skills. You will need to have previous experience with accounting software, Microsoft Excel, can problem solve, and have strong customer service skills. Our office hours are 7:30am-4:30pm Monday through Friday. We offer a generous benefits package, Paid Time Off with an additional 10 days off for major holidays, life insurance, and a 401k program. Compensation will be based on experience. National Time and Signal is a family owned and operated Michigan company that manufactures Clock and Fire Alarm systems.
